Q: Is 82,541,866 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 82,541,866 is a composite number.

Why is 82,541,866 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 82,541,866 can be evenly divided by 1 2 11 22 739 1,478 5,077 8,129 10,154 16,258 55,847 111,694 3,751,903 7,503,806 41,270,933 and 82,541,866, with no remainder.

Since 82,541,866 cannot be divided by just 1 and 82,541,866, it is a composite number.
